ASP进阶教程:技术驱动的站长实战指南

ASP(Active Server Pages)作为一种早期的服务器端脚本技术,至今仍被许多站长用于构建动态网站。虽然现代开发框架如ASP.NET已逐渐取代其地位,但掌握ASP的核心原理和技术仍然对理解Web开发有重要帮助。

在实际应用中,ASP通过嵌入VBScript或JScript代码实现动态内容生成。站长可以利用ASP处理表单数据、操作数据库以及生成个性化页面。例如,通过ADO(ActiveX Data Objects)组件,可以直接从数据库中读取信息并展示给用户。

技术驱动的站长需要深入理解ASP的工作机制。比如,ASP页面在服务器端执行,然后将结果发送到客户端浏览器。这种模式使得页面内容可以根据用户请求实时生成,提升了用户体验和网站灵活性。

实战过程中,站长应注重代码的可维护性和安全性。避免直接使用用户输入的数据进行数据库操作,以防止SQL注入等安全问题。同时,合理使用缓存机制可以提高网站性能。

AI设计,仅供参考

除了基础功能,ASP还支持自定义组件和对象,这为复杂功能的实现提供了可能。通过组合不同组件,站长可以构建更强大的网站系统。

总体而言,ASP虽非最新技术,但在特定场景下依然具有实用价值。对于希望深入了解Web开发原理的站长来说,学习ASP不仅能提升技术能力,还能为后续学习其他语言和框架打下坚实基础。

dawei

【声明】:安庆站长网内容转载自互联网,其相关言论仅代表作者个人观点绝非权威,不代表本站立场。如您发现内容存在版权问题,请提交相关链接至邮箱:bqsm@foxmail.com,我们将及时予以处理。